Bed bugs disrupt sleep, leave bites, and can spread from room to room through furniture or bedding. In Fort McCoy's warm climate, they can stay active year-round inside homes and travel easily with used items.
Small rust-colored blood spots on mattress seams, sheets, or nearby furniture
Translucent shed skins in mattress seams, box springs, or furniture crevices
Clusters of red, itchy bites often appearing in a straight line on arms or back

You wake up with bites, spot tiny stains on sheets, or find specks along a mattress seam. In Fort McCoy, bed bugs can show up in any home because they travel with furniture, luggage, and visitors. Fast treatment helps calm the stress and bring back better sleep.
We start with a careful inspection of beds, box springs, headboards, baseboards, couches, and nearby clutter where bed bugs hide. The technician looks for live bugs, shed skins, dark spotting, and seam activity, then maps the affected rooms so treatment reaches the right places. Bed bug service often uses targeted heat, product application, or a mix of methods depending on the home and the level of activity. During the visit, you can expect a detailed room-by-room look and clear steps for laundering, bagging, or moving items.
After treatment, bed bug activity should fall as hidden bugs contact treated areas and exposed spaces are addressed. Some homes need more than one visit because eggs and hidden bugs can survive if only part of the room gets treated. Follow-up monitoring helps confirm that bites and sightings stop over time.
